While reviewing the Luminar contrast-audit service for the Pellwick storefront, I found that the staging instance has drifted from the committed baseline. The WCAG threshold set in staging is stricter than production, so the audit flags components that pass in prod, which explains the inconsistent CI results Marisol reported. Please compare carefully against the repo manifest before approving; the sampling rate and palette-cache TTL also appear to differ. The values currently live on staging are as follows.

settings of fafog-haduf:
ZORIX_PIN=4648
ZORIX_METRICS_HOST=metrics.zorix.paliqsys.corp
ZORIX_LOG_LEVEL=info
ZORIX_TENANT=druix

## Onboarding – Catalogue Import Review

The Quillbranch import pipeline ingests catalogue records from partner libraries nightly. Records are validated, deduplicated, and written to the holdings schema; rejected rows go to a quarantine table with reason codes. The importer runs under a least-privilege account with insert-only access. For your security review, audit trails live in the import_log table, queryable via the read-only connection string below.

replica DSN, kajep-yahag: mssql://praok_svc:iF@db-8d68.plorvaio.local:5432/eliion

The Larkspur Mall kiosks are cycling because the watchdog in the Pinefold shell was deployed with the staging environment file instead of production. The heartbeat endpoint therefore rejects the kiosk's check-ins, and the watchdog treats each rejection as a hang. Copy the production env template onto the unit, verify `WATCHDOG_INTERVAL=30`, and confirm the heartbeat host points at the production cluster. Then add the watchdog's authentication line directly beneath that entry.

sealed setting: VAULT_KEY20=c8ea1e419912889df6b4

Heads up: tonight's release includes a regenerated static-analysis baseline for the Oakmere monorepo. The Sentrylint rule pack upgrade surfaced about 300 pre-existing findings, so we refreshed the baseline file rather than gating the release on them. New code is still checked against the full rule set. If CI complains about a baseline hash mismatch, rerun the refresh task before escalating; do not edit the file manually. Triage tickets for the suppressed findings land next sprint. The deployed artifact corresponds to the token below.

trace token, tawep-fahif: htk3_b58